The Move to Undocument the Documented
Do you remember the legislation that now dictates that passports must be shown at US land borders? It went into effect on June 1, 2009 I believe. That’s almost two years ago. Here is a link to the old passport application form. When this became law, many of us shrugged it off with the reasoning that is was for homeland security and that it was logical to show papers to get back into the country to prove who you were and that you were a documented American. Now I wonder…
I live about 100 miles from the Canadian border. Just a few years ago, we could drive over the border just by showing our driver’s license.
